Temperature dependent synthesis of micro- and meso-porous silica employing the thermo-responsive polymer of poly(N-isopropylacrylamide) as structure-directing agent
作者:Yan, Rui; Zhang, Minchao; Zhang, Wangqing; 等.
關(guān)鍵字:structure-directing agent
論文來源:期刊
具體來源:JOURNAL OF SOL-GEL SCIENCE AND TECHNOLOGY
發(fā)表時間:2011年

www.springerlink.com/content/e810u86w2783537q/

Temperature dependent synthesis of micro- and meso-porous silica employing the thermo-responsive homopolymer poly(N-isopropylacrylamide) or the random copolymer poly(N-isopropylacrylamide-co-acrylic acid) as structure-directing agent (SDA) and Na2SiO3 as silica source is proposed. The thermo-responsive character of the SDA provides the advantages including (1) temperature dependent synthesis of microporous silica, hierarchically micro-mesoporous silica, and mesoporous silica just by changing the aging temperature below or above the low critical solution temperature of the thermo-responsive SDA, and (2) elimination of the thermo-responsive SDA from silica matrix by water extraction. The synthesis mechanism is discussed, and the effect of the aging temperature and the weight radio of SDA/Na2SiO3 on the synthesis of micro- and meso-porous silica are studied. Microporous silica, hierarchically micro-mesoporous silica and mesoporous silica with the surface area at 3.5-9.0 x 10(2) m(2)/g and the pore volume at 0.28-1.13 cm(3)/g and the average pore size ranging from 1.1 to 9.0 nm are synthesized. The strategy affords a new and environmentally benign way to fabricate porous silica materials, and is believed to bridge the gap between the synthesis of microporous and mesoporous silica materials.
